diff options
Diffstat (limited to '.circleci')
-rw-r--r-- | .circleci/config.yml | 14 | ||||
-rw-r--r-- | .circleci/verbatim-sources/header-section.yml | 14 |
2 files changed, 24 insertions, 4 deletions
diff --git a/.circleci/config.yml b/.circleci/config.yml index a4bcd4b16f..db6d27412b 100644 --- a/.circleci/config.yml +++ b/.circleci/config.yml @@ -22,7 +22,7 @@ setup_linux_system_environment: &setup_linux_system_environment name: Set Up System Environment no_output_timeout: "1h" command: | - set -e + set -ex # Set up CircleCI GPG keys for apt, if needed curl -L https://packagecloud.io/circleci/trusty/gpgkey | sudo apt-key add - @@ -33,7 +33,17 @@ install_official_git_client: &install_official_git_client name: Install Official Git Client no_output_timeout: "1h" command: | - set -e + set -ex + + sudo killall apt-get || true + sudo rm /var/lib/apt/lists/lock || true + sudo rm /var/cache/apt/archives/lock || true + sudo rm /var/lib/dpkg/lock || true + + cat /etc/apt/sources.list + sudo sed -i 's#archive.ubuntu.com/ubuntu#us-east-1.ec2.archive.ubuntu.com/ubuntu#g' /etc/apt/sources.list + sudo sed -i 's#security.ubuntu.com/ubuntu#us-east-1.ec2.archive.ubuntu.com/ubuntu#g' /etc/apt/sources.list + cat /etc/apt/sources.list sudo apt-get -q -y update sudo apt-get -q -y install openssh-client git diff --git a/.circleci/verbatim-sources/header-section.yml b/.circleci/verbatim-sources/header-section.yml index 6febfb9c55..5e691ef771 100644 --- a/.circleci/verbatim-sources/header-section.yml +++ b/.circleci/verbatim-sources/header-section.yml @@ -22,7 +22,7 @@ setup_linux_system_environment: &setup_linux_system_environment name: Set Up System Environment no_output_timeout: "1h" command: | - set -e + set -ex # Set up CircleCI GPG keys for apt, if needed curl -L https://packagecloud.io/circleci/trusty/gpgkey | sudo apt-key add - @@ -33,7 +33,17 @@ install_official_git_client: &install_official_git_client name: Install Official Git Client no_output_timeout: "1h" command: | - set -e + set -ex + + sudo killall apt-get || true + sudo rm /var/lib/apt/lists/lock || true + sudo rm /var/cache/apt/archives/lock || true + sudo rm /var/lib/dpkg/lock || true + + cat /etc/apt/sources.list + sudo sed -i 's#archive.ubuntu.com/ubuntu#us-east-1.ec2.archive.ubuntu.com/ubuntu#g' /etc/apt/sources.list + sudo sed -i 's#security.ubuntu.com/ubuntu#us-east-1.ec2.archive.ubuntu.com/ubuntu#g' /etc/apt/sources.list + cat /etc/apt/sources.list sudo apt-get -q -y update sudo apt-get -q -y install openssh-client git |